根据给定的文件信息,以下是对“TSO入门word文档”的详细解读,主要涉及主机动态存储优化(TSO)的基础知识、数据集(DATASET)的管理与使用,以及在TSO环境中进行数据集操作的具体步骤。 ### 主题:TSO入门与主机文件基础知识 #### TSO简介 TSO,即Time Sharing Option,是IBM MVS操作系统中的一个子系统,允许用户通过终端或工作站以交互方式登录并控制计算机资源和应用程序。用户登录TSO后,可以通过命令行或图形界面(如ISPF)来执行各种任务,包括但不限于文件管理和程序调试。 #### 数据集(DATASET) 数据集是IBM大型机中文件的一种实现方式,类似于PC上的文件。数据集的命名规则严格,名字由四个部分组成,总长度不超过44个字符,每部分之间用点分隔,且每个部分的长度不超过8个字符,不能以数字开头。例如,“IBMUSER.UTIL.JCLLIB”。 #### 数据集的类型与结构 数据集主要有两种组织形式:PS(顺序文件)和PDS(分区数据集)。PS数据集是一种简单的顺序存储方式,而PDS则可以包含多个成员(MEMBER),常用于存储程序、作业控制语言(JCL)和加载库等。数据记录的格式有多种,如FB(固定长度阻塞)、VB(变长阻塞)和U(不定长,用于LOAD库)。 #### 文件系统的管理 主机的文件系统通过目录(CATALOG)进行管理。当定义了一个数据集时,该数据集会被分配到特定的磁盘卷上,其信息将被记录在该卷的VTOC(卷表)中。在没有目录管理的情况下,访问数据集需要指定卷的信息,这类似于Windows系统中的文件查找。为了更好地管理大量数据,引入了目录的概念。目录分为MASTER CATALOG和USER CATALOG两种,前者用于存储系统数据集信息,后者由用户自定义,用于管理用户自己的数据集。 #### TSO下的数据集操作 在TSO环境中,用户可以通过命令行或ISPF图形界面来进行数据集的创建、删除和其他管理操作。在命令行模式下,用户可以直接输入MVS命令,如`ALLOCATEDATASET`来分配数据集;而在ISPF模式下,操作更为直观,用户可通过菜单选项进行数据集的管理,如分配数据集时选择“3Utilities”->“2DataSet”,然后输入数据集名及相关属性,完成数据集的创建。 ### 实例操作详解 以创建数据集“IBMUSER.UTIL.JCLLIB”为例,用户首先选择进入ISPF模式,然后选择“3Utilities”->“2DataSet”,输入数据集名称。接下来,用户需填写数据集的属性面板,包括空间单位、初次分配量、每次扩展分配量、目录块数量及记录格式等。例如,设置空间单位为“TRKS”(3390-3磁盘的1个TRK等于56664字节),初次分配10个TRK,每次扩展也分配10个TRK,目录块为10个TRK,记录格式为FB(固定长度阻塞)。 通过上述操作,用户不仅能够在TSO环境下熟练地管理数据集,还能深入了解主机文件系统的工作原理及其高效的数据管理机制。这为后续的程序开发和系统维护工作奠定了坚实的基础。
2025-08-25 14:45:47 113KB cobol
1
该软件共分为3部分上传,请全部下载后,点击NetExpress.part1.rar打开。 Micro Focus是一家成立于1976年的英国上市公司,为企业用户提供与企业应用开发、测试、管理及现代化相关的产品和解决方案。 该软件为 Net Express 5.1 。可以在Windows 7 平台上使用。 安装时提示需要注册码,可以直接无视。
2025-08-24 08:09:15 50MB Express COBOL
1
该软件共分为3部分上传,请全部下载后,点击NetExpress.part1.rar打开。 Micro Focus是一家成立于1976年的英国上市公司,为企业用户提供与企业应用开发、测试、管理及现代化相关的产品和解决方案。 该软件为 Net Express 5.1 。可以在Windows 7 平台上使用。 安装时提示需要注册码,可以直接无视。
2025-08-23 06:30:18 50MB Express COBOL
1
【日立COBOL85开发环境】是专为在日文Windows操作系统下进行COBOL编程设计的一款集成开发环境(IDE)。COBOL(Common Business Oriented Language)是一种古老但依然广泛应用的编程语言,主要用于商业数据处理和企业级系统的开发。这个开发环境特别适合学习和理解COBOL的基本语法、程序结构以及如何在实际环境中应用。 日立COBOL85的特点在于它提供了友好的用户界面,使得开发者能够在日文环境下方便地编写、编译和调试COBOL代码。其功能可能包括: 1. **源代码编辑器**:支持COBOL的语法高亮、自动完成和错误检查,帮助初学者快速编写正确的代码。 2. **编译器**:能够将源代码转换为可执行文件,日立的编译器可能具有优化选项,以提高程序性能。 3. **调试工具**:允许设置断点、单步执行、查看变量值等,便于查找和修复程序中的错误。 4. **项目管理**:方便组织和管理多个COBOL程序,支持版本控制和构建流程。 5. **文档和资源**:可能包含COBOL的参考手册、教程和其他学习资料,帮助用户快速入门。 在使用日立COBOL85开发环境时,应注意以下几点: - **兼容性**:确保你的Windows系统是日文版,因为该环境是为这种特定系统设计的,可能无法在其他语言版本的Windows上运行。 - **许可证问题**:虽然该环境可用于学习,但在商业开发中使用前,务必了解并确认使用权责,避免侵犯版权或违反许可协议。 - **语言特性**:COBOL语言具有其独特的语法结构,例如使用词法结构(IDENTIFICATION DIVISION, PROCEDURE DIVISION等),学习时需适应其与现代编程语言的不同之处。 - **数据库集成**:COBOL经常用于处理大量数据,日立的开发环境可能集成了对常见数据库系统的支持,如Oracle、DB2等,学习时应掌握如何进行数据库交互。 - **社区支持**:由于COBOL的悠久历史,网上有许多相关的论坛和社区,可以寻找解答问题的资源和经验分享。 日立COBOL85开发环境是学习和实践COBOL编程的一个有效工具,尤其对于那些需要在日文环境中工作的开发者来说。通过深入理解和熟练使用这个环境,可以提升对COBOL编程的技能,为商业领域的软件开发打下坚实基础。
2025-08-13 15:42:40 24.7MB cobol window
1
《大型机Mainframe技术深度解析》 在信息技术领域,大型机Mainframe以其强大的处理能力、高可用性和安全性闻名。本资料全集涵盖了Mainframe的核心组件和技术,包括OS390操作系统、DB2数据库系统、CICS交易处理系统、COBOL编程语言、VSAM文件系统以及JCL作业控制语言,是学习和深入了解大型机技术的重要资源。 1. **OS390操作系统**:OS390是IBM大型机系统的核心,为用户提供了一个稳定的运行环境。它支持多任务并行处理,确保高效率的系统资源利用,并具备出色的故障恢复机制。OS390提供了丰富的管理工具,如性能监控、存储管理和安全性控制,确保系统的稳定运行。 2. **DB2数据库系统**:DB2是IBM开发的关系型数据库管理系统,尤其适用于大型数据处理场景。DB2在Mainframe上表现出了卓越的性能和可靠性,支持大规模并发访问和复杂查询,广泛应用于金融、电信等行业。DB2课堂讲义中将详细介绍其架构、SQL语法及优化策略。 3. **CICS交易处理系统**:CICS(Customer Information Control System)是IBM为大型机设计的一种在线事务处理系统,用于实时处理大量并发的业务交易。CICS文档将深入讲解如何配置和管理CICS域,以及如何编写和调试CICS程序。 4. **COBOL编程语言**:COBOL(Common Business Oriented Language)是一种面向商业应用的编程语言,特别适合处理数据处理和文件操作任务。在大型机环境中,COBOL仍然占据主导地位,是编写企业级应用的首选语言。"cobol.rar"可能包含了COBOL的基本语法、程序设计范例和调试技巧。 5. **VSAM文件系统**:Virtual Storage Access Method(VSAM)是IBM为Mainframe设计的一种高效文件访问方法,它可以提供快速的数据存取和直接存取能力。VSAM文件系统在银行、保险等行业的数据处理中发挥着关键作用,因为它能够处理大量实时数据。 6. **JCL作业控制语言**:JCL(Job Control Language)是Mainframe上调度和控制作业执行的语言。通过JCL,用户可以定义作业流程,包括输入输出处理、资源分配和作业执行顺序。"mainframe.txt"和"OS390.txt"可能包含了JCL的相关示例和最佳实践。 本资料全集对于想要从事或已经在Mainframe环境下工作的IT专业人士来说,是一份宝贵的参考资料。通过深入学习和实践,你可以掌握大型机环境下的核心技术和操作技巧,提升在高并发、大数据处理领域的专业技能。无论你是准备面试还是希望提升现有技能,这些文档都将助你一臂之力。
2024-10-06 18:07:34 13.72MB cobol mainframe
1
精通 cobol 源代码精通 cobol 源代码精通 cobol 源代码精通 cobol 源代码
2024-05-31 21:01:55 115KB cobol
1
Koopa(COBOL)解析器生成器 Koopa是为COBOL设计的解析器生成器。 COBOL解析器可以隔离处理源文件(无需预处理),并且不介意CICS / SQL片段的存在。 语法易于扩展,可将对整体代码的影响降至最低。 查阅以获取有关原始设计决策的详细信息。 特征 孤岛解析器生成器 COBOL词法分析器和解析器 接受免费,固定和可变格式的COBOLCOBOL 85测试套件和语法单元测试涵盖 具有语法突出显示,轮廓,快速导航和基于XPath的查询的COBOL查看器 解析树的XML转储 COBOL预处理器: 抄写本扩展,支持REPLACING REPLACE声明 发牌 除非实际文件或文件夹中另有说明,否则Koopa中的所有内容均受BSD许可证的保护。 testsuite/cobol85文件夹中的文件是英国国家计算中心提供的COBOL85测试套件,最初在找到。 这里的版本的不同
2024-04-10 14:36:37 5.99MB COBOL
1
基于ProLeap ANTLR4的COBOL解析器 这是一个基于的COBOL解析器,它为COBOL代码生成抽象语法树(AST)和抽象语义图(ASG)。 AST以语法树结构表示普通的COBOL源代码。 ASG通过语义分析从AST生成,并提供数据和控制流信息(例如,变量访问)。 EXEC SQL,EXEC SQLIMS和EXEC CICS语句被提取为文本。 该解析器是受测试驱动开发的,通过了NIST测试套件,已成功应用于银行和保险业的许多COBOL文件。 :dizzy: 如果您喜欢我们的工作,请加星号。 例子 输入:COBOL代码 Identification Division. Program-ID. HELLOWORLD. Procedure Division. Display "Hello world". STOP RUN. 输出:抽象语法树(AST) (startRul
2024-04-09 16:05:58 5.19MB parser grammar antlr cobol
1
同事那里搞到的cobol资料,具体也没看,拿来分享分享吧
2023-10-13 14:52:25 3.73MB cobol
1
cobol入门到精通等
2023-10-13 14:44:14 55.01MB cobol
1